Access to clean fuels and technologies for cooking, urban in Sri Lanka
Sri Lanka: Access to clean fuels and technologies for cooking, urban was 72.5% in 2023. ▲ Rising
Access to clean fuels and technologies for cooking, urban in Sri Lanka, 2000–2023
Source: Tracking SDG 7: The Energy Progress Report, International Energy Agency (IEA), note: License: Creative Commons Attribution—NonCommercial 3.0 IGO (CC BY-NC 3.0 IGO). Measured in % of urban population.
Analysis
In 2023, access to clean fuels and technologies for cooking, urban in Sri Lanka stood at 72.5%. That is the highest value across all 24 years on record.
That represents a change of up 1.5% on the previous year and up 18.5% over ten years.
Over the whole period, access to clean fuels and technologies for cooking, urban in Sri Lanka peaked at 72.5% in 2023 and was at its lowest, 49.9%, in 2000.
That places Sri Lanka 137th out of 189 countries with data for 2023, putting it in the middle of the range.
The long-run direction has been consistently rising across the 24 years of available data.
Access to clean fuels and technologies for cooking, urban in Sri Lanka, year by year
| Year | % of urban population | Change |
|---|---|---|
| 2000 | 49.9% | — |
| 2001 | 51.1% | +2.4% |
| 2002 | 51.8% | +1.4% |
| 2003 | 52.7% | +1.7% |
| 2004 | 53.1% | +0.8% |
| 2005 | 53.5% | +0.8% |
| 2006 | 54.4% | +1.7% |
| 2007 | 55.0% | +1.1% |
| 2008 | 55.7% | +1.3% |
| 2009 | 56.6% | +1.7% |
| 2010 | 57.3% | +1.1% |
| 2011 | 58.7% | +2.4% |
| 2012 | 59.8% | +1.9% |
| 2013 | 61.2% | +2.3% |
| 2014 | 62.8% | +2.6% |
| 2015 | 64.1% | +2.1% |
| 2016 | 65.3% | +1.9% |
| 2017 | 66.8% | +2.3% |
| 2018 | 68.0% | +1.8% |
| 2019 | 68.8% | +1.2% |
| 2020 | 69.9% | +1.6% |
| 2021 | 70.6% | +1.0% |
| 2022 | 71.4% | +1.1% |
| 2023 | 72.5% | +1.5% |

About this data
Access to clean fuels and technologies for cooking, urban is the proportion of urban population primarily using clean cooking fuels and technologies for cooking. Under WHO guidelines, kerosene is excluded from clean cooking fuels.
